'Hollow Tree and Deep Woods Book' Summary
The book follows the evenings spent with the Little Lady and the Storyteller. The Little Lady, a four-year-old with an insatiable appetite for stories, enjoys the tales the Storyteller spins for her each night. The book is a collection of these stories, each one meticulously crafted to capture the young girl's imagination. The stories often take place in fantastical settings, filled with adventurous characters and magical elements. Throughout the book, the narrator highlights the Little Lady's particular fondness for the older stories, insisting on them being told in their original form, emphasizing her sense of familiarity and comfort with the well-loved narratives.
